Networking for Results

We all know the value of networking, but when was the last time someone gave you professional advice on what to do when you walk into that room?

We are excited to have North America’s Networking Guru, Michael Hughes, host a Networking for Results session for our WiDS membership at the KPMG office in Ottawa. During this 90-minute session, Michael will address the most common networking myths, explore secret network principles, and discuss success strategies for creating and leveraging a network of relationships. Participants will take part in skill-building exercises and discover how to maximize every networking contact.

Don’t miss this opportunity to build your interpersonal and relationship-building skills.

Stay for the Fall Reception

The event will be followed by our Fall Reception. The reception will host international senior military officers who are visiting Canada as part of the 2019 Halifax Peace with Women Fellowship. These accomplished, diverse, active duty women from NATO and NATO-partner countries are looking forward to networking with you and sharing their experiences.

Registration for the workshop includes the reception. No separate registration or payment is required.
